    Coach vs Owner in Franchise mode


    What is the difference between Coach career and owner career in Franchise mode, BESIDES the owner beingv able to relocate team and stadium uogrades etc??

    As the owner are you able to do everything the coach can PLUS the stadium stuff or is there a difference?

    As the owner are you able to do everything the coach can PLUS the stadium stuff or is there a difference? YES

    Owner mode is everything coach mode is but you can hire/fire head coach/trainer/scout, set the prices on concessions/merchandise/tickets, and have the ability to relocate/upgrade.

    The only benefit to playing as coach is if you don't want to have to do the micromanaging of the concessions and such.

          Also it should be noted that if you play as a coach you can get fired, whereas, as an owner, you cannot.

          For my online league, we prefer that as a feature since many years in, users get new jobs, new challenges and new divisional foes and matchups.

          So, I consider that the main sell of coach mode, frankly.
